Description: In September 2019, the Stanislaw Moniuszko International Competition of Polish Music took place in Rzeszów, whose main goal was to promote Polish compositions and to draw the attention of musicians around the world to them. The auditions were divided into two categories (performances by pianists and chamber ensembles), which meant that, in less than 10 days, the audience had the opportunity to commune with countless extremely rarely performed gems of Polish music. Dux presents selected competition interpretations of participants of auditions in both categories, giving us if not actual premiere recordings, then quite a bit of stuff that is very rare on disc (with, it must be admitted, a few “bleeding chunks”).
